When considering partnering with Smart Business Solutions as your accountant and tax advisory partner, you can expect a thorough and proactive approach to managing your finances.
We start with a request for essential information before our first Proactive Accounting Meeting, ensuring that our discussions are
purposeful and focused. During the Proactive Accounting Meeting, we delve into your current financial position, income streams, and goals
for your business. We also explore how these business goals align with your personal and lifestyle aspirations. This meeting is an
opportunity to discuss any challenges you're facing, such as growth or cash flow issues, and to identify opportunities for business
development. Our timeline of the way we work helps manage client expectations for timeframes and workflow, ensuring that our partnership
is transparent and efficient. At Smart Business Solutions, we're committed to providing proactive and tailored support to help you
achieve your business and financial goals.

The headlines say negative gearing is "gone." For most investors, that is not what the new law does.
From 1 July 2027, the 50% CGT discount will be replaced — for individuals, trusts and partnerships — by two mechanisms working together: indexation of the asset's cost base, and a minimum 30% tax on the resulting net gain.

A car fringe benefit commonly arises when an employer makes a car they own or lease available for the private use of an employee.
The Australian Government is revising tax incentives for electric vehicles, including phasing out Fringe Benefits Tax (FBT) exemptions for pl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EVs). Businesses providing these vehicles to employees must understand the impact of these changes and take necessary steps before the deadline.
Why should you lodge an FBT return where no FBT is payable? Well, for the simple reason that it turns on a three-year deadline for the ATO to commence audit activities.
